Balkan Stream is a Bulgarian project and will continue to be built

Political instability and US sanctions are affecting current gas pipeline projects, Kiril Temelkov, a former executive director of Bulgartransgaz, told the BNR. But energy projects are long-term, for this reason Temelkov believes it is unlikely the next government in Bulgaria will decide that the Balkan Stream project will not be implemented. 
Deputy Prime Minister Tomislav Donchev commented that he did not expect that the US sanctions against the Russian Turkish Stream project would affect the Bulgarian Balkan Stream pipeline. This project should be seen as an expansion of Bulgaria's gas pipeline system, carried out by the state-owned company Bulgartransgaz, the deputy prime minister said.
